Background
The working area during road engineering and construction engineering construction comprises a main engineering working surface, a material storage yard, an office area and the like, and when the project is located in a city area, the whole project working area is covered, so that the safety and ordered production of the project are ensured, and meanwhile, the safety risk brought by wrong entering of social residents is avoided.
At present, four types of color steel corrugated enclosing plates, foam sandwich plates, brick walls and assembled steel plates are adopted during urban engineering project construction. The basic heights of various heights are 2.0-3.0 m. The color steel corrugated enclosing plate and the foam sandwich plate are anchored on the road surface by adopting a steel support frame, the color steel corrugated enclosing plate and the foam sandwich plate are stabilized by adopting an inclined strut mode, the brick wall enclosing and the assembled steel plate enclosing and installing are realized by adopting a concrete band-shaped foundation, the widths of the two support modes are required to reach 0.8-1.0 m, and land resources in a public space of a tense urban area are wasted; various enclosed night lighting effects are poor, and the effect is biased to the warning function, so that the brightening function is weakened; various enclosing patterns and styles are not attractive, the adverse effect on urban environments is large, and the traveling environment of residents is reduced; various construction enclosing covers lack of corresponding water blocking facilities, so that construction muddy water overflows out of a construction area at a construction site, and the environment is polluted; most of the surrounding facilities lack dustproof facilities, and dust on the construction site is easily dispersed outwards in sunny days, so that the environment is influenced and the like.
Among the prior art, patent number CN214091344U discloses a construction encloses and covers device, including a plurality of enclosing and cover the unit, enclose and cover the unit and include: the upright post comprises a first upright post and a second upright post, wherein the first upright post and the second upright post are separated by a certain distance, the bottoms of the first upright post and the second upright post are connected to a base, and the base is connected with a driven-in foundation steel bar; the potted plant green plant support assembly is arranged on the first upright post and the second upright post; the potted plant is green to plant, lay in green support component that plants cultivated in a pot forms ecological green and plants the board, as enclosing and cover the face, has reduced the construction and has enclosed and cover area, beautify the construction and enclose and cover the style, has improved the requirement of view nature, has important meaning to promotion construction regional urban image, improvement peripheral resident living environment, improvement construction regional peripheral road traffic safety, improvement trip condition etc..
Although this technical scheme can be used to promote the urban image of construction area, improve surrounding resident living environment, improve construction area surrounding road traffic safety and improve travel condition etc. when relevant constructor need open a place export, need dismantle the frame that corresponds between two stands, but above-mentioned technical scheme is when using, and the frame between two stands is inconvenient for the user to dismantle fast, and it is also inconvenient that it is in the nimble use of this enclosing shielding device that should enclose the shielding device and accomplish to retrieve the recycling at later stage construction simultaneously.

Referring to fig. 1-6, a road construction enclosure device comprises a base 1, a connecting disc 2 is installed on the upper end face of the base 1, upright posts 3 are arranged on the upper surface of the connecting disc 2, the number of the upright posts 3 is multiple, a frame 6 is arranged between the two upright posts 3, an enclosure plate 7 is connected to the outer wall of the frame 6, a plurality of groups of symmetrically arranged positioning blocks 8 are fixedly installed at two ends of the frame 6, a butt joint block 4 which is matched with the spacing between the two positioning blocks 8 is fixedly installed at the corresponding positions of the outer wall of the upright posts 3 and each group of positioning blocks 8, a mounting groove 10 is formed in the butt joint block 4 in a penetrating manner, a limit groove 9 which is matched with the mounting groove 10 is formed in the positioning blocks 8 in a penetrating manner, and a limit assembly is connected in the mounting groove 10 in a sliding manner.
The road construction enclosure device provided by the utility model can separate a construction area from a resident living area through the arrangement of the enclosure device when in use, the main structure in the technical scheme is similar to the main structure of the construction enclosure device disclosed by the patent number CN214091344U, a plurality of groups of upright posts 3 are erected through a plurality of bases 1 by a user, a frame 6 and an enclosure baffle 7 are arranged between every two upright posts 3, when the enclosure device is required to be assembled, the plurality of groups of positioning blocks 8 arranged at the tail end of the frame 6 are correspondingly clamped and installed at the positions of the opposite connection blocks 4 by the user, the frame 6 can be initially installed between the two upright posts 3, then a limiting assembly arranged in an installation groove 10 on the opposite connection block 4 sequentially penetrates through the plurality of opposite connection blocks 4 from top to bottom so as to position blocks 8, dislocation separation between the positioning blocks 8 and the opposite connection blocks 4 can be avoided under the effect of the limiting assembly, and simultaneously, the two ends of the frame 6 can be prevented from being separated from the upright posts 3, the frame 6 is stably installed between the two upright posts 3, the outer wall of the frame 6 is installed on the outer wall of the baffle 7, the whole frame 6 can be pulled down in the position of the enclosure device when the whole enclosure device is required to be disassembled from the two upright posts 6, and the assembly is required to be detached from the position of the enclosure device when the frame 6 is required to be detached from the position of any side.
As shown in fig. 3 and fig. 4, the limiting component specifically includes a limiting rod 5, a plurality of groups of dismounting grooves 13 matched with the positioning blocks 8 are formed on the outer wall of one end of the limiting rod 5, which is close to the frame 6, when the limiting rod 5 slides to enable the dismounting grooves 13 formed on the outer wall of the limiting rod to be on the same horizontal line with the positioning blocks 8, a user pulls the frame 6 to enable the positioning blocks 8 to be pulled outwards through the dismounting grooves 13, so that the frame 6 can be dismounted, and when the limiting rod is in normal use, the dismounting grooves 13 on the limiting rod 5 and the positioning blocks 8 are in dislocation arrangement, so that two ends of the frame 6 can be prevented from being separated from the upright posts 3, and the frame 6 is stably mounted between the two upright posts 3.
As shown in fig. 5, the limiting assembly further comprises a fixed block 11, the fixed block 11 is fixedly connected with the outer wall of the upper end of the upright post 3, the fixed block 11 is provided with a supporting rod 15 in a threaded connection mode, the outer wall of the lower end of the supporting rod 15 is rotationally connected with the upper end face of the limiting rod 5, when the limiting assembly is used, a user can rotate the supporting rod 15, the supporting rod 15 can drive the limiting rod 5 to move up and down through threaded transmission between the supporting rod 15 and the fixed block 11, and the limiting rod 5 can be conveniently used for adjusting the limiting rod 5 up and down while limiting the moving position of the limiting rod 5.
As shown in fig. 4, the connecting disc 2 is provided with a relief groove 12 matched with the limit rod 5, the relief groove 12 can provide a basis for the downward moving distance of the limit rod 5, and when the lower end of the limit rod 5 abuts against the inner wall of the bottom of the relief groove 12, the limit rod 5 can be positioned at the optimal limit position of the frame 6.
As shown in fig. 5, the screw block 14 is fixedly mounted at the upper end of the supporting rod 15, and the cross section of the screw block 14 is hexagonal, and the hexagonal screw block 14 can increase the friction between the hand of the user and the outer wall of the screw block 14, so that the user can rotate the supporting rod 15 conveniently.
As shown in fig. 1 and fig. 2, a plurality of the butt joint blocks 4 are uniformly distributed on the peripheral side of the outer wall of the upright post 3, and the butt joint blocks 4 are arranged on the peripheral side of the upright post 3, so that a plurality of frames 6 can be combined by the butt joint blocks 4 in different directions in the enclosure device, and different functional areas can be conveniently separated from the construction area.
As shown in fig. 2, 3, 4 and 5, the distance between the upper end surface of the limiting rod 5 and the bottom surface of the fixed block 11 is the same as the depth of the yielding groove 12, and the matching arrangement of the distance between the limiting rod 5 and the fixed block 11 and the depth of the yielding groove 12 can enable the limiting rod 5 to move upwards to correspond to the position of the positioning block 8 and the dismounting groove 13 when the limiting rod is propped against the fixed block 11, at the moment, a user can detach the positioning block 8 by pulling the frame 6, and when the bottom surface of the limiting rod 5 is propped against the bottom inner wall of the yielding groove 12, the positioning block 8 and the dismounting groove 13 are dislocated, so that the limiting rod 5 plays a limiting role on the frame 6 through the positioning block 8.
